@ -1,22 +1,22 @@
var ipc=require('../../../node-ipc');
/***************************************\
*
*
* UDP Client is really a UDP server
*
* Dedicated UDP sockets on the same
*
* Dedicated UDP sockets on the same
* machine can not be bound to in the
* traditional client/server method
*
*
* Every UDP socket is it's own UDP server
* And so must have a unique port on its
* machine, unlike TCP or Unix Sockts
* which can share on the same machine.
*
*
* Since there is no open client server
* relationship, you should start world
* first and then hello.
*
*
***************************************/

#node-ipc test harness
***TestHarness was intended to be run on linux.***
*the test.js file is intended to start and run all of the files in the test folder*
A full regression test should be done before each release to npm to insure that no expected or previously documented bugs pop up again.
This will also help to ensure that each new release does not create any additional bugs. However, it can never fully ensure no new bugs will be created.
Any bug that is reported and testable, which should be 99.9% of bugs, should have a test written and added to the test folder after fixing.
